What Does NFS Stand For?

NFS can stand for multiple phrases, each unique to its context. Here are a few of the most common meanings of NFS:

  • Not For Sale: This is perhaps the most common interpretation of NFS. It is often used in marketplaces or advertisements to indicate that an item is not available for purchase.
  • No Funny Stuff: In a more casual setting, NFS can mean that someone does not want to engage in frivolous or joking behavior.
  • Need For Speed: In the gaming community, NFS is frequently associated with the popular racing video game series, "Need for Speed."

How is NFS Used in Different Contexts?

The meaning of NFS can change significantly based on the context in which it is used. Here are a few examples:

  • In a real estate listing, "NFS" might indicate that a property is not for sale.
  • In a gaming forum, players might use "NFS" to discuss the latest updates or features in the "Need for Speed" franchise.
  • During a conversation, someone might say "NFS" when they are not in the mood for jokes or light-hearted banter.
